Software Developer J2EE (Washington, DC Area)
Description:

Dakota Consulting, Inc., is a woman-owned, SDB, 8(a) IT services company headquartered in Silver Spring, MD. Dakota is a growing, progressive business that offers competitive salary, benefits, and a commitment to quality to our clients.

Dakota Consulting, Inc. is seeking a Software (J2EE) Developer to perform application development tasks for a federal customer. The ideal candidate should have extensive programming background with Object Oriented Programming and strong system development life cycle skills (SDLC). The candidate should be well versed in software development practices, methodologies (Agile, Scrum, Iterative), application testing approach, and various design and development models.

This position requires the candidate to have the ability to assess the current state of existing applications, develop and identify plan for identifying and correcting software defects, and completion of coding for existing requirements within a short time frame.

Job Functions:

Responsibilities include:
  • Assist with architecture, design, development, deployment, and management of existing applications
  • Software development in J2EE environment
  • Knowledge of software testing methodologies and overseeing application testing
  • Assess current state of existing applications to identify, manage, and fix software defects, and develop additional code as needed
  • Resolve technical issues through debugging, research and investigation
  • Effective communication with technical specialists, project manager, and clients
Qualifications:
  • 3 or more years work experience desired in Java and J2EE technologies
  • 3 or more years hands-on database skills working with Oracle, Sybase, MySQL, MS SQL Server or other relational database
  • Experience in WebSphere, WebLogic or other web servers, configuration and administration, Subversion, and maintaining Ant scripts
  • 3 or more years demonstrated experience with XML, XML Schema, XSLT
  • Must possess specific skill set (JEE core technologies) - JSF (RichFaces Impl), JBoss Seam/Weld, EJB 3.0, JPA (Hibernate Impl), and JBoss AS
  • Must possess 1 skill from each of the following sets:
    • jBPM/jPDL or JBoss ESB
    • BPEL or BPM
    • JAX-WS or JMS
    • Oracle PL/SQL or SQL
    • Facelets or FreeMarker
    • Ant or Maven
    • Spring
    • Hibernate
    • Web services (REST, SOAP)
  • Ideally possess specific skill set - JasperSoft (Reports and Server), and Eclipse or NetBeans IDE
  • Experience working within application development for federal sector projects is desirable
  • Some experience with JUnit or other unit testing tools
  • Good understanding of Weblogic and other app/web servers is desirable
  • Excellent interpersonal skills
  • Strong SDLC process approach to software engineering
Education/Training and Certification:
  • 4 year degree or equivalent experience in a related field is required
